FAQ: How did we track down the leaked file descriptors in Brindlecore? We wrapped every socket open in the Tallyhook auditor, diffed descriptor tables across request cycles, and found the culprit in the retry path of the Ostrem fetcher, which dropped handles on timeout without closing them. Reviewers should check that all new I/O paths use the guarded wrapper. To reopen the sealed audit archive, enter the recovery passphrase below.

strongbox words: istwyn-normir-silwyn-ulaius-istwyn

## Service Accounts

Plugin authors integrating with the Timetablr solver must use a dedicated service account rather than personal credentials. Service accounts are scoped to read-only schedule queries by default; write access requires review by the Nordquist platform team. Each account authenticates to the solver gateway with the key shown below.

gateway credential: zpat4_qSKI

Ticket: Staging env misconfigured for Siftgate bloom filter

The bloom layer in front of the Pellet KV store is rejecting all lookups in staging because the env file was copied from the dev template without credentials. False-positive tuning values are fine; only the auth line is missing. To unblock the weekly demo, the Pellet admission secret must be set on the following line.

env line for yaguf-fajop: LEDGER_TOKEN13=fb08984397349

## Data Stores: Monthly Partitioning

The Orvane events table is partitioned by calendar month. New partitions are created automatically on the 25th, giving a buffer before rollover. Queries must include a timestamp predicate or the planner scans every partition. Partitions older than 18 months are detached and archived. For inspection during the sync, use the connection string below.

database URL for kawig-hahog: mongodb://ulador_svc:aF4YK3bpHxBm2h@db-6f0d.ferrahq.corp:5432/druox

Before enabling permessage-deflate on the Hollowfen edge nodes, remember the tradeoff: compression cuts bandwidth roughly 60% on chatty dashboards but raises per-connection memory by several kilobytes, which matters at our concurrency levels. Keep the context takeover disabled unless the traffic review says otherwise, and watch heap graphs for thirty minutes after rollout. Once metrics look stable, sign the release manifest before promoting to the Dunecrest region, using the signing key below.

release key, bawig-kahip: bky4_bSxn